CONMED Price Performance
CONMED (NYSE:CNMD –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, January 28th. The company reported $1.43 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.32 by $0.11. CONMED had a net margin of 4.75% and a return on equity of 14.22%. The firm had revenue of $373.20 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$366.88 million.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$1.34 earnings per share. The firm’s revenue was up 7.9% on a year-over-year basis. Equities research analysts predict that CONMED will post 4.35 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About CONMED
CONMED Corporation (NYSE: CNMD) is a global medical technology company headquartered in Utica, New York. Founded in 1970, CONMED develops, manufactures and markets a broad portfolio of surgical devices and accessories for minimally invasive procedures. The company’s product line supports surgeons and healthcare providers in specialties including orthopedics, general surgery, gastroenterology and gynecology.
CONMED operates two principal segments: Orthopedics, and Visualization & Energy.
